Why we use Bulkheads
Bulkheads are used at the tunnel mouth to prevent air escaping from the tunnel and allows you to put more air into the tunnel, to compress it, pressurizing the tunnel. The bulkhead effectively acts as a seal, preventing any air from escaping the tunnel. It is used ordinarily in interventions (when a Tunnel boring Machine needs its face inspecting to check the quality of the tooling), to support ground pressure.
To allow the workers to inspect the tooling, they must stand in-front of the TBM exposing themselves to unsupported ground, which could potentially collapse. Compressed Air is used to support the face by using a ‘pressure’ of air to prevent the ground closing in.
